Program
F. Schubert - F. Liszt: "Soirées de Vienne" A brilliant Liszt transcription of Schubert's famous waltzes, combining the elegance of Viennese waltz with Liszt's virtuosic piano technique.
R. Schumann: Toccata Op. 7 One of Schumann's most technically challenging works, demonstrating incredible speed and precision in performance.
F. Liszt: "Liebestraum" (Dreams of Love) Liszt's famous lyrical piece, full of tenderness and romance, requiring deep emotional immersion from the performer.

F. Liszt: Mephisto Waltz A diabolically challenging piece depicting a scene from Goethe's "Faust." Demands virtuosic technique and dramatic interpretation from the pianist.
F. Chopin: Scherzo No. 2 One of Chopin's most famous and technically demanding works, combining drama, lyricism, and virtuosity.
G. Verdi - F. Busoni: Elegy No. 4 - "Turandot's Awakening" A unique Busoni transcription based on Verdi's opera, requiring deep understanding of operatic dramaturgy and virtuosic technique.
P. Tchaikovsky - M. Pletnev: Two pieces from "The Nutcracker"
  • Pas de deux
  • Intermezzo Elegant Pletnev transcriptions from Tchaikovsky's famous ballet, requiring the pianist to convey orchestral colors on the piano.


F. Liszt: "La Campanella" One of the most virtuosic pieces in the piano repertoire, based on Paganini's theme. A true challenge even for the most experienced pianists.

'Du sollst der Kaiser meiner Seele sein'
In a life spanning almost ninety-five years, Robert Stolz wrote in excess of 2000 songs, dances and marches, as well as the music for more than 50 stage works, 60 films and 19 ice revues. The song 'Du sollst der Kaiser meiner Seele sein' is part of the operetta 'Der Favorit' (1916) and sung by Manon, the female leading figure of this forgotten piece. This song became well known by performances by great sopranos as Lucia Popp, Elisabeth Schwarzkopf and Renee Flemming.

Michael Bulychev-Okser
Michael Bulychev-Okser
Piano, USA
Michael Bulychev-Okser is an internationally
acclaimed American pianist, composer, and producer. A recipient of "Who's Who in Music", Mr. Bulychev-Okser performed at the world's most prestigious stages: Carnegie Hall, Merkin Hall, Kennedy Center, La Salle Pleyel (France), Wigmore Hall (London), Rachmaninov Hall (Russia), Suur Saal (Estonia), and Centermex Theater (Mexico).

Bulychev- Okser organizes international music events: Gershwin International Music competition in New York and Classical Hugs Music Festival in Estonia. Michael is a guest performer at numerous music festivals, competitions, and concert series in England, France, Germany, Mexico, Israel, Estonia, Georgia, Ukraine, Austria, Finland, South Korea, China, Serbia, Singapore, and the United States.

In 2022, Michael Bulychev-Okser performed
Mendelssohn's Double Concerto with a renowned virtuoso violinist, Shlomo Mintz. Michael Bulychev-Okser is a Professor of Piano and Chamber Ensembles at Lucy Moses School at Kaufman Music Center.
